The shipping industry is the foundation of global trade, allowing the motion of items throughout continents and supporting economies worldwide. Comprehending the numerous shipping strategies used today is crucial for services that depend on the efficient and timely delivery of products. As shipping methods have evolved over the years, they have become more advanced, using a series of alternatives to match various types of cargo and delivery requirements.

Among the basic shipping methods is containerisation. Introduced in the mid-20th century, containerisation revolutionised the shipping industry by standardising the method items are transferred. Containers, usually 20 or 40 feet in length, can carry a wide range of goods, from electronic devices to fabrics. Using containers simplifies filling and dumping processes, decreases the risk of damage to items, and enables easier handling at ports. Today, most freight ships are developed to carry countless these containers, making it possible to move large quantities of items efficiently across the globe. This strategy has also assisted in intermodal transport, where containers are moved effortlessly between ships, trains, and trucks, even more improving the speed and efficiency of international shipping.

Another essential technique in contemporary shipping is the use of specialised vessels. Various types of freight require various handling and transport conditions, causing the development of specialised ships customized to specific requirements. For example, bulk providers are designed to carry unpackaged bulk goods such as grains, coal, and iron ore. These ships are geared up with large freight holds and hatches for effective packing and dumping. Similarly, tanker ships are utilized to transport liquids like oil, chemicals, and melted gas (LNG). These vessels are developed with security features to prevent leaks and spills, making sure that dangerous products are transported safely. Roll-on/roll-off (Ro-Ro) ships are another kind of specialised vessel, used mainly for carrying cars and equipment. These ships are designed with ramps that enable lorries to be driven on and off the vessel, simplifying the packing procedure.

Recently, improvements in technology have introduced brand-new strategies that further enhance the effectiveness and sustainability of shipping. One such strategy is the use of autonomous ships. Self-governing ships, or unmanned vessels, are geared up with innovative navigation systems, sensors, and artificial intelligence (AI) to operate with very little human intervention. These ships can making real-time choices based upon information inputs, such as weather conditions and traffic in shipping lanes. The development of autonomous shipping is anticipated to minimize human mistake, lower operating expense, and enhance security at sea. Additionally, these vessels can operate more efficiently, potentially decreasing fuel usage and emissions. While completely self-governing ships are still in the early stages of advancement, trials are currently underway, and they are anticipated to play a substantial function in the future of shipping.

Another strategy getting attention is sluggish steaming. Sluggish steaming includes running cargo ships at lower speeds to minimize fuel usage and emissions. While this method increases transit time, it provides considerable environmental benefits and cost savings for shipping companies. Sluggish steaming ended up being especially popular throughout the worldwide financial crisis of 2008 when high fuel prices and decreased demand led shipping business to look for methods to cut costs. By decreasing the speed of their vessels, companies were able to lower fuel intake by approximately 30%. In addition, sluggish steaming can decrease wear and tear on engines, extend the lifespan of ships, and decrease the probability of mishaps. As concerns about climate modification continue to grow, slow steaming is most likely to remain a key strategy in the shipping market's efforts to decrease its environmental effect.
